Maryland ss Memorandum that this prsent Day to wit upon the 7th day of October 1672 came Thomas Jones who aswell on the behalfe of the Right honoble the Lord Propiy as for himself giveth the Court here prsent to undrstand and be informed. That whereas he the said Thomas Jones who aswell &c being one of his Lopps Justices for the County of Worcester having Received information that one Peter Hance a Dutchman had imported into this Province from New yorke six Mares Contrary to the Act of Assembly in that case made and provided the said Thomas who aswell &c did upon the 24th day of August last past at the Hore Keele in Worcester County aforesayd caused ye said six Mares to be seized & taken into his possession in the behalfe of the Right honoble the Lord Propry, and the said Thomas who aswell &c in fact saith that the said six mares were brought from New Yorke & imported into this Province contrary to ye said Act aforesayd which he is ready to averre & prove, whereupon he humbly prayes the Advice of this honoble Court & Judgemt for the Condemnation of ye said six Mares & that the one halfe of ye said Mares may be adjudged to the said Lord Proprietary and the other halfe to ye sd Jones according to the Tenor of ye said Act of Assembly. Tho Jones. Upon the said In formation Exhibited to ye Cort by the said Thomas Jones in his proper pson the Court awarded processe to be issued to the said John Hance to answere ye prmises. etc the next Cort. The Cort Adjourned untill the Tenth of Decemb next p. 513 Maryland ss.
